    Default Andy, Open it up!

    The QB competition ..... open it up.

    If it's truly about putting the best team on the field, then why not have a fair, unbiased competition at QB?

    Is Smith so good that nobody else deserves a chance to compete for the starting job? Ha, I doubt it. The facts certainly don't support that.

    It's obvious that the pass offense has been the weakest link on the team.

    For the past 2 years, the rush offense has been top 10 ranked; the defense has been top 10 ranked; the special teams have been top 5 ranked in returns, and the Chiefs have gotten 15 return TDs (kickoff, punt, fumble, INT) the past 2 years -- that's #1 in the NFL over that span.

    The pass offense has been ranked 24th and 29th.
    Is the QB position not accountable to that?

    Why shouldn't Chase Daniel (and to a lesser extent, Aaron Murray) get a legitimate shot to win the job?

    That is all well and good.....BUT....HOW MUCH SHOULD WE SPEND TAKING A CHANCE????

    Forget about the mistakes of the past. They are spilt milk. Water over the dam. A failed lottery ticket

    DEAL WITH THE PRESENT AND FUTURE.

    We won't be getting a top 10 pick anytime in at least the next 4 or 5 years. FACT. Our Defense alone will prevent that.

    So what are the chances we get a chance at a true star potential QB without trading away half our picks to get him? Answer....just about NONE.

    So what is the answer? Obviously what Reid and Dorsey are doing....building a great team around the QB we have while constantly trying to find a great QB we can get with the kind of picks we are going to have. We outbid Miami for Bray. We grabbed Murray. 2 QBs in 3 drafts. It's not like Reid and Dorsey aren't trying to find Smith's replacement. They are trying almost every year.

    It was just our luck that in the 2013 draft when we had the #1 overall pick there wasn't a QB that was worth a dirty diaper.
